    Understanding the ESL Snapdragon Tournament

    Alright, before we get to the juicy details about RRQ, let's quickly understand what the ESL Snapdragon tournament is all about. Think of it as a huge, global esports competition, and it's a really big deal! It's organized by ESL, one of the biggest names in esports, and sponsored by Qualcomm Snapdragon, hence the name. The tournament features several popular mobile games, which means a wide range of gamers get a chance to show off their skills. It's a platform for teams and individual players to compete for glory and of course, some serious prize money! There are different stages of the tournament, including qualifiers, group stages, and playoffs. The best teams from various regions battle it out to become champions. The tournament format can vary, but generally, it involves online qualifiers, leading to regional finals, and eventually, the grand finals, where the top teams from around the world compete. The whole thing is designed to test the skills and strategies of the players, making it a thrilling spectacle for fans. Getting into the ESL Snapdragon is no easy feat. Teams and players must perform exceptionally well in the qualifiers and regional tournaments to earn a spot. This makes the competition intense and highly rewarding for those who make it.
